Output 6cd052b531f0319bedbbf4cf6b4e116405942e98bfbd98bcaa2ff857f8077309:6

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b11729dd13c13719fa32eb502a4939249f25957 OP_EQUAL
address
3P7wcutrWJFqFNc5GjiXCEwUALq6eN4BJv
transaction
6cd052b531f0319bedbbf4cf6b4e116405942e98bfbd98bcaa2ff857f8077309
confirmations
533635
spent
true